A revision of * Shifāʼ al-asqām fī waḍʻ al-sāʻāt ʻalá al-rukhām of Abū al-ʻAbbās Aḥmad ibn ʻUmar al-Ṣūfī late 13th cent.
Whence the authorʼs full name appears as Zayn al-Dīn ʻAbd al-Raḥmān ibn Muḥammad ibn Muḥammad, known as Ibn al-Muhallabī, al-Muwaqqit. He is therefore presumably the Zayn al-Din ʻAbd al-Raḥmān al-Muwaqqit of Brock. S1, p. 798, no. 78
